RJ-45 Pin Assignment
RJ-45 Pin Assignment of PoE
With 100BASE-TX/10BASE-T cable, pins 1 and 2 are used for transmitting data, and pins
3 and 6 for receiving data; pins 4, 5, 7 and 8 are used for power supplying.
Pin out of Cisco non-802.3af standard PD
Pin Signal
1 RX+
2 RX-
3 TX+
4 VCC -
5 VCC -
6 TX-
7 VCC +
8 VCC +
Pin out of PoE Midspan Hub/Switch
Pin Signal / Name
1 RX+
2 RX-
3 TX+
4 VCC+
5 VCC+
6 TX-
7 VCC-
8 VCC-
Pin out of PoE Endspan Hub/Switch
Pin Signal / Name
1 TX+/VCC+
2 TX-/VCC+
3 TX+/VCC-
4
5
6 TX-/VCC-
7
8
Note ‗+‘ and - signs represent the polarity of the wires that make up each wire pair. Before you power
PD, please check the RJ-45 connector pin assignment follow IEEE802.3af standard; otherwise you
may need to change one of the RJ-45 connector pin assignment attached with the UTP cable.
